Solution for 7a-4+2a=3a+2 equation:


Simplifying
7a + -4 + 2a = 3a + 2

Reorder the terms:
-4 + 7a + 2a = 3a + 2

Combine like terms: 7a + 2a = 9a
-4 + 9a = 3a + 2

Reorder the terms:
-4 + 9a = 2 + 3a

Solving
-4 + 9a = 2 + 3a

Solving for variable 'a'.

Move all terms containing a to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-3a' to each side of the equation.
-4 + 9a + -3a = 2 + 3a + -3a

Combine like terms: 9a + -3a = 6a
-4 + 6a = 2 + 3a + -3a

Combine like terms: 3a + -3a = 0
-4 + 6a = 2 + 0
-4 + 6a = 2

Add '4' to each side of the equation.
-4 + 4 + 6a = 2 + 4

Combine like terms: -4 + 4 = 0
0 + 6a = 2 + 4
6a = 2 + 4

Combine like terms: 2 + 4 = 6
6a = 6

Divide each side by '6'.
a = 1

Simplifying
a = 1
